Deadweight Force Standards (2)

Most accurate force standard machine (2x10-5)

High cost and size for large force

Deadweight force standard machines in the world 4 MN : NIST(USA) 2 MN : PTB(Germany) 1 MN : PTB(Germany), NPL(UK), IMGC(Italy),

NIM(China) … 500 kN : KRISS(Korea), NMIJ(Japan), NMIA(Australia),

LNE(France), CEM(Spain) …

Hydraulic Force Standards (2)

Amplification of force (Q) by hydraulic system Amplification factor : 200 ~ 1000

Relative Uncertainty : 1x10-4

Possibility of large force standards

Complex technology and still high cost

Hydraulic force standard machines in the world 20 MN : NMIJ(Japan), NIM(China) 16.5 MN : PTB(Germany) 5 MN : PTB(Germany) 2 MN : KRISS(Korea)

Build-up Force Standards (2)

Force comparator with the reference of build-up force measuring system

Easy way to reach large force

Relative uncertainty : 2x10-4

Build-up force standard machines in the world 30 MN : NPL(UK) 10 MN : KRISS(Korea) 9 MN : LNE(France)

Uncertainty of Build-up FSM

Uncertainty of the build-up system (%) Repeatability 0.00298 Resolution 0.00005 Interpolation 0.00007 Zero recovery 0.00088 Temperature variation 0.00012 Creep 0.00277 Long term sensitivity drift 0.00289 Reference force 0.005 Combines uncertainty : 0.00712

Uncertainty due to servo control (%) Repeatability 0.00048 Deviation from target value 0.00025 Resolution 0.00004 Combined uncertainty : 0.00054

Expanded uncertainty of build-up FSM (%) 0.01428 Declination of 0.02 %

Summary

Build-up system Parallel combination of force transducers Capability of large force measurement

Build-up force standard machine Force comparator with the reference force from build-

up system Easy and economic way to establish large force

standards

Large force dissemination by using build-up system Large force up to 3 times of the force standards
